USD/CAD, USD/JPY Seen as Most Resilient USD-Pairs

USD/CAD, USD/JPY Seen as Most Resilient USD-Pairs

Talking Points:

- EURUSD, GBPUSD maintain uptrends after tests of supports.

- USDCAD, USDJPY maintain breakout levels after retests.

- See the May forex seasonality report.

The US Dollar is faring better against some currencies (AUD, CAD, JPY) rather than others, which have proven to be more resilient (EUR, GBP). Nevertheless, the bottoming potential in the USDOLLAR Index persists, pulling into focus today's US inflation data as a potentially important catalyst.
